Nebraska State Patrol, Nebraska
End of Watch Friday, April 10, 1953
Add to My HeroesJohn T. Meistrell
Trooper John Meistrell succumbed to injuries he received in a vehicle crash on Highway 275 on March 31, 1953.
Trooper Meistrell was traveling on Highway 275 when he lost control on the rain-slicked road and struck a tree about a mile from the Highway 275 and Highway 77 junction. He was transported to Dodge County Hospital with a broken neck. He succumbed to his injuries ten days later.
Tropper Meistrell had served with the Nebraska State Patrol for 13 years. He was survived by his wife, two children, three brothers, and one sister.
